Creative Ideas for Labubu Halloween Costumes
If you are wondering how to get started, there are endless themes you can explore. The key is to match the costume to the character's mischievous personality. Here are a few popular inspirations for your next project:
- The Classic Spooky Ghost: Use white felt or thin, lightweight fabric to create a simple shroud with cutouts for the eyes and ears.
- The Miniature Vampire: A small black cape with a crimson satin lining is iconic. Pair it with a tiny bow tie to make your Labubu look like a dapper Dracula.
- Pumpkin Patch Spirit: Use orange yarn or felt to create a small pumpkin-shaped headpiece or a onesie that makes the character look like a garden dweller.
- Witchy Vibes: Craft a tiny pointed hat from construction paper or felt, complete with a small broomstick accessory made from twigs.
Regardless of the theme, ensure that the materials you use are soft and non-abrasive to prevent damaging the plush fur of your collectible figure. Always prioritize the preservation of your toy while having fun with the styling.
⚠️ Note: Always remove any metal pins or sharp adhesives from your Labubu Halloween Costume to ensure the long-term safety and condition of the doll's material.
Materials You Will Need
To create a professional-looking DIY outfit, you do not need expensive equipment. Many of the best Labubu Halloween Costume designs utilize scraps from around the house. Below is a breakdown of essential supplies for your crafting kit.
| Material | Purpose |
|---|---|
| Felt Sheets | Perfect for capes, hats, and non-fraying clothing. |
| Fabric Glue | For bonding seams without the need for sewing. |
| Miniature Ribbons | Useful for bows, ties, and securing items to the figure. |
| Acrylic Paint | For adding small, non-permanent details or facial accents. |
| Velcro Strips | Ideal for making the outfit easy to take on and off. |
How to Assemble Your Labubu Costume
The assembly process should be treated as a fun, low-pressure hobby. First, measure your Labubu to ensure the costume will fit correctly without being too tight or restricting the movement of the limbs. Start by creating a pattern on paper; once you are happy with the shape, transfer it to your chosen fabric.
Begin with the base layer of the clothing, such as a simple cape or a body-hugging onesie. Once the base is set, layer on your decorative elements like buttons, sequins, or tiny pumpkin patches. If you are attaching heavy accessories, use a small elastic band instead of glue to ensure that the Labubu Halloween Costume remains modular and easy to change once the holiday season passes.
💡 Note: When working with adhesive, apply a very thin layer to avoid staining the plush fabric. Test on an inconspicuous area of the fabric first.
Showcasing Your Collection During Spooky Season
Once your Labubu is dressed to impress, the next step is styling them for photography or display. Many collectors enjoy setting up "spooky dioramas" using fake cobwebs, tiny plastic spiders, and ambient LED lights. Positioning your costumed Labubu in the center of these scenes creates a whimsical, high-quality image that is perfect for sharing on social media platforms like Instagram or TikTok.
Lighting is crucial for these miniature photoshoots. Using a warm, dim light source can simulate a campfire or candlelight, which enhances the Halloween atmosphere. Remember to adjust your camera's focus on the Labubu's face—specifically the eyes and the unique "teeth" design—to make the character pop against the background.
Maintaining Your Figures Post-Halloween
After the festivities end, it is important to store your Labubu Halloween Costume pieces properly to keep them in good condition for next year. Place individual outfits in small, airtight bags to keep them free from dust and moisture. If the costumes are made of fabric, you can lightly mist them with a fabric refresher before storing them away. Ensure that your Labubu figures themselves are cleaned gently with a dry, soft-bristled brush to remove any residue from the costume accessories, keeping your collection pristine for your next creative endeavor.
